Lamha | لمحة
Locations: Mahmoud Elyan Al-faouri Jordan , Headquarters, JO + (+1 more)
Company Size: 1 - 100
Industry: Entertainment Providers
Locations: Mahmoud Elyan Al-faouri Jordan , Headquarters, JO + (+1 more)
Company Size: 1 - 100
Industry: Entertainment Providers